Hướng dẫn how do i install or enable phps gmp extension? - làm cách nào để cài đặt hoặc kích hoạt tiện ích mở rộng phps gmp?

Để có sẵn các chức năng này, PHP phải được biên dịch với hỗ trợ GMP bằng cách sử dụng tùy chọn-với-GMP.--with-gmp option.

Arancaytar dot ilyaran tại gmail dot com ¶

13 năm trước

Note that this parameter requires a path, as in --with-gmp=DIR, if gmp is installed in a non-standard location, which is almost always the case when you are building your own PHP installation in your home directory.

Obvious, but it's an easy mistake.

Xu hướng Elydreams ¶

11 thàng trước

On Debian platforms, make sure you install the gmp development library first:

    sudo apt-get install libgmp-dev

Just like other extensions, you need the libs installed before php compile will gracefully complete all.

Omagaldadze tại Yahoo Dot Com ¶

9 năm trước

On ArchLinux php 5.4.14-1 I had to uncomment the line

extension=gmp.so

in /etc/php/php.ini file.

Obvious, but it's an easy mistake.0

oharry0535 tại gmail dot com ¶

3 năm trước

Obvious, but it's an easy mistake.2

Obvious, but it's an easy mistake.3

Obvious, but it's an easy mistake.4

Miquelfire ¶

13 năm trước

Obvious, but it's an easy mistake.6

Xu hướng Elydreams ¶

13 năm trước

Obvious, but it's an easy mistake.7

Obvious, but it's an easy mistake.8

Obvious, but it's an easy mistake.9

Xu hướng Elydreams ¶

9 năm trước

On Debian platforms, make sure you install the gmp development library first:

    sudo apt-get install libgmp-dev

3

oharry0535 tại gmail dot com ¶

3 năm trước

5

Gnu nhiều độ chính xác

  • Giới thiệu
  • Installing/Configuring
    • Yêu cầu
    • Cài đặt
    • Cấu hình thời gian chạy
  • Hằng số được xác định trước
  • Ví dụ
  • Chức năng GMP
    • gmp_abs - giá trị tuyệt đối
    • GMP_ADD - Thêm số
    • gmp_and - bitwise và
    • gmp_binomial - tính toán hệ số nhị thức
    • gmp_clrbit - Bit rõ ràng
    • GMP_CMP - So sánh số
    • GMP_COM - Tính toán bổ sung của một người
    • gmp_div_q - chia số
    • gmp_div_qr - chia số và nhận thương số và còn lại
    • gmp_div_r - phần còn lại của sự phân chia số
    • gmp_div - bí danh của gmp_div_q
    • GMP_DIVEXACT - Sự phân chia chính xác của các số
    • gmp_export - xuất sang chuỗi nhị phân
    • GMP_FACT - Factorial
    • GMP_GCD - Tính GCD
    • GMP_GCDEXT - Tính toán GCD và số nhân
    • gmp_hamdist - khoảng cách Hamming
    • gmp_import - nhập từ chuỗi nhị phân
    • GMP_INIT - Tạo số GMP
    • gmp_intval - chuyển đổi số gmp thành số nguyên
    • gmp_invert - nghịch đảo bởi modulo
    • GMP_JACOBI - Biểu tượng Jacobi
    • gmp_kronecker - biểu tượng kronecker
    • GMP_LCM - Tính LCM
    • gmp_legendre - biểu tượng huyền thoại
    • GMP_MOD - Hoạt động Modulo
    • gmp_mul - nhân số
    • GMP_NEG - Số phủ định
    • gmp_nextprime - Tìm số nguyên tố tiếp theo
    • gmp_or - bitwise hoặc
    • GMP_PERFECT_POWER - Kiểm tra điện hoàn hảo
    • GMP_PERFECT_SAQUARE - Kiểm tra vuông hoàn hảo
    • GMP_POPCOUNT - Số lượng dân số
    • GMP_POW - Nâng số lên điện
    • GMP_POWM - Nâng số lên điện với modulo
    • GMP_PROB_PRIME - Kiểm tra xem số có "có lẽ là Prime"
    • gmp_random_bits - số ngẫu nhiên
    • gmp_random_range - số ngẫu nhiên
    • gmp_random_seed - Đặt hạt giống RNG
    • gmp_random - số ngẫu nhiên
    • GMP_ROOT - Lấy phần nguyên của root thứ n
    • GMP_ROOTREM - Lấy phần nguyên và phần còn lại của root thứ n
    • gmp_scan0 - quét cho 0
    • gmp_scan1 - quét cho 1
    • gmp_setbit - đặt bit
    • gmp_sign - dấu hiệu của số
    • gmp_sqrt - tính toán căn bậc hai
    • gmp_sqrtrem - căn bậc hai với phần còn lại
    • gmp_strval - chuyển đổi số gmp thành chuỗi
    • GMP_SUB - Số lần trừ
    • gmp_testbit - kiểm tra nếu một chút được đặt
    • gmp_xor - bitwise xor
  • GMP - Lớp GMP
    • GMP :: __ sê -ri - tuần tự hóa đối tượng GMP
    • GMP :: __ unserialize - giảm dần tham số dữ liệu vào đối tượng GMP

Ẩn danh ¶

10 năm trước

6

7

8

Làm cách nào để kích hoạt tiện ích mở rộng GMP?

Mô -đun GMP theo mặc định được thêm vào PHP.Bạn có thể kích hoạt giống nhau bằng cách loại bỏ (;); tiện ích mở rộng = GMP được thêm vào đầu phần mở rộng trong php.ini.removing the (;) ;extension=gmp added at the start of the extension in php. ini.

Làm cách nào để cài đặt các tiện ích mở rộng PHP?

Khởi động lại PHP của bạn..
Cài đặt gói phát triển PHP ..
Tải xuống và giải nén mã nguồn PHP5 ..
Chuẩn bị phần mở rộng (PHPize).
Định cấu hình và thực hiện tiện ích mở rộng ..
Di chuyển phần mở rộng ..
Chỉnh sửa Php.ini của bạn ..
Khởi động lại PHP của bạn ..

Làm cách nào để bật các tiện ích mở rộng PHP trong Windows?

Trên Windows, bạn có hai cách để tải tiện ích mở rộng PHP: biên dịch nó thành PHP hoặc tải DLL.Tải một tiện ích mở rộng trước là cách dễ nhất và ưa thích nhất.Để tải một phần mở rộng, bạn cần có sẵn nó dưới dạng tệp ". DLL" trên hệ thống của bạn.compile it into PHP, or load the DLL. Loading a pre-compiled extension is the easiest and preferred way. To load an extension, you need to have it available as a ". dll" file on your system.